Doors and Windows in the UK: A Comprehensive Guide

In the UK, the significance of doors and windows extends far beyond mere aesthetics. They play a crucial role in energy performance, security, and convenience in homes. With a wide array of designs, materials, and technologies readily available, house owners should make informed choices to ensure their selections satisfy their needs and preferences. This article explores the kinds of windows and doors commonly discovered in the UK, recent trends, energy effectiveness standards, and installation factors to consider.

Types of Doors in the UK

Selecting the ideal door is important for enhancing the functionality and look of a home. Different styles deal with diverse tastes and requirements:

Type of DoorDescription
Front DoorsTypically made from wood or composite materials, these doors provide the very first impression of a home. They typically include ornamental elements that complement the home's style.
Back DoorsNormally less decorative than front doors, back entrances ought to focus on security and ease of access, typically including reinforced styles.
Bi-fold DoorsPopular in homes with gardens, bi-fold doors can totally open a space, merging indoor and outdoor living. They are normally made from aluminum or wood.
French doors Windows UkThese double doors swing open from the center, using a timeless look and making them ideal for patios or gardens.
Patio area DoorsSliding outdoor patio doors are a space-saving alternative, including big glass panes to make the most of natural light and views.
Security DoorsDesigned with strengthened materials and locks, these doors provide increased security, making them ideal for susceptible access points.

Key Features to Consider

  • Material: Options vary from timber, uPVC, and aluminum. Each has particular advantages concerning insulation, resilience, and upkeep.
  • Thermal Performance: Look for doors with great thermal scores (usually labelled as U-values), which suggest their efficiency in insulating versus heat loss.
  • Security Features: Multi-point locking systems, toughened glass, and robust frames boost security.
  • Looks: The style ought to match the home's style, whether standard, contemporary, or somewhere in between.

Types of Windows in the UK

Windows are important for ventilation, natural lighting, and energy efficiency. Below are typical kinds of windows utilized in the UK:

Type of WindowDescription
Casement WindowsHinged at the side, casement windows open outside and are popular for offering outstanding ventilation.
Sash WindowsTypically found in older buildings, sash windows consist of 2 sliding panels and can be single or double hung.
Tilt and TurnThese versatile windows can be slanted inwards for ventilation or turned totally for cleaning, making them user-friendly.
Bay and Bow WindowsThese extending windows produce a sensation of space, permitting more light into the space and often offering a panoramic view.
Set WindowsFixed and non-opening, these windows maximize views and natural light without jeopardizing energy performance.
SkylightsInstalled on the roofing, skylights generate plentiful light and can help in minimizing energy expenses when properly put.

Secret Features to Consider

  • Energy Efficiency: Look for double or triple glazing to enhance insulation and lower energy costs.
  • Frame Materials: Options include wood, vinyl, aluminum, and fiberglass, each with its advantages and disadvantages relating to aesthetic appeals and durability.
  • Security: Locking mechanisms and laminated glass enhance the security of windows.
  • Design Style: The window design need to match the overall architecture of the home.

Current Trends in Doors and Windows

The marketplace for windows and doors in the UK continues to progress, driven by customer needs for enhanced performance and aesthetics. Some popular trends consist of:

  1. Smart Technology: Integration of clever locks, sensors, and automated systems for enhanced security and convenience.
  2. Sustainable Materials: Increasing choice for eco-friendly and sustainable products like recovered wood and energy-efficient glazing.
  3. Colour Choices: A shift from traditional white to bold colours, permitting property owners to reveal individual design.
  4. Minimalistic Designs: Clean lines and inconspicuous styles are gaining popularity, particularly with bi-fold and sliding doors.
  5. Optimizing Natural Light: Larger windows and open designs that blur the lines between inside your home and outdoors are significantly searched for.

Energy Efficiency Standards

With sustainability ending up being a top priority, energy efficiency in doors and windows is essential. The UK abides by stringent structure regulations focused on decreasing carbon footprints:

  • U-Values: Indicates how much heat is lost through a window or door-- the lower the U-value, the better the insulation.
  • Energy Ratings: Windows and doors are frequently ranked on a scale from A++ to E, showing their energy efficiency.
  • Glazing Options: Double or triple-glazing windows prevent heat loss and enhance energy efficiency.

Installation Considerations

Setting up windows and doors properly is paramount to ensure efficiency and security. Consider these factors:

  • Professional Installation: Hiring vetted specialists increases the possibility of an effective installation.
  • Structure Regulations: Compliance with regional building guidelines is vital for safety and energy efficiency.
  • Maintenance: Regular evaluations and upkeep can extend the life-span of doors and windows.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What is the very best material for external doors?

  • The finest product depends upon specific needs. Lumber is traditional and aesthetically pleasing, while composite and uPVC provide high toughness and low maintenance.

2. How can I enhance the energy effectiveness of my windows?

  • Upgrading to double glazing, using thermal curtains, or applying window movies can visibly improve insulation.

3. What should I look for in security features for doors?

  • Try to find strong materials, multi-point locking mechanisms, and strengthened frames.

4. Are bi-fold doors ideal for little areas?

  • Yes, bi-fold doors can open up and develop a simple transition between indoors and outdoors without taking up much area when open.

5. How often should I replace my windows?

  • Windows generally last around 15-20 years, but signs of wear, bad insulation, and condensation can indicate the need for replacement earlier.

In conclusion, selecting the best windows and doors is a vital choice for UK homeowners, affecting not just aesthetic appeal but likewise security and energy efficiency. By considering the types available, the products, and the recent trends, house owners can make informed choices that boost their home while contributing to environmental sustainability.
